A big thank you to volunteers Anna, Tania, Phil and Chris for joining Gemma for a community litter pick in Sheerness this morning, during which they collected 18kg of litter. The volunteers met at 31 Broadway in Sheerness. Sheppey Matters’ new location, and worked their way up to Beachfields car park to the Swimming pool, back along the Broadway up to the Town Clock, finishing at Trinity Place car park and back to base for a well earned cuppa.
It was a lovely sunny day and it was great to see the Spring bulbs, planted by another group of volunteers at the end of last year, emerging in the planters along the way.
